## Deployment — Canary Gating

Vexhall releases promote through a canary stage before full rollout. The gate evaluates error rate, p95 latency, and saturation over a rolling window; any breach halts promotion and pages the release manager. Manual overrides require two approvals and are logged. Do not shorten the observation window under deadline pressure. The gating thresholds currently in effect are as follows.

settings of yagag-baweg:
[briael]
host = briael.paliqworks.internal
user = briael_svc
database = briael_prod

## Authentication

The Fennwick billing worker swaps traffic via blue-green on the Ostram scheduler. Both colors share one auth scope; do not mint per-color credentials or the ledger reconciler double-counts. Rotate only during a green-idle window, then flip. Health checks hit /authz before cutover. The worker reads its credential from the deploy manifest, and the current key for the Ostram control plane is below.

API key for yahig-tadup: kto7_ubizbYm

The renewal of our three-year agreement with Torvane Materials has been assessed in detail. Proposed terms include a 4.2% unit-price increase, partially offset by improved volume rebates and extended payment terms of sixty days. Sensitivity analysis indicates a net annual cost impact of under 1% on the Meridia product line, assuming stable demand. Legal has flagged no material changes to liability clauses. We recommend approval, subject to the conditions outlined in the confidential note below.

confidential, yawip-bahif: Zorokox Partners plans to lower the Casax list price by 28.0 percent in April. The board signed off on a budget of $271.0 million for Project Juldor. The renewal with Pelokox Partners closes at $410.1 million a year, 3.4 percent below the last contract. Project Pelok slips by a full year because of the audit delay.

Account Recovery — Pagewright Static Builds

If a customer loses access to their Pagewright dashboard, incremental rebuilds of their static site will continue from the last known-good deploy, so no content is lost during recovery. Confirm the customer's last rebuild timestamp in the Orlin console, then initiate the recovery flow from the admin panel. Do not trigger a full rebuild until access is restored. Unlocking the recovery flow requires the passphrase below.

recovery phrase for yadup-taguf: wenael-quenox-kelix